Boustany Announces $1.8 Million Grant and Loan to Improve Water Quality in Maurice and Vermillion Parish

Washington, D.C. – U.S. Representative Charles W. Boustany, Jr., MD, R-Southwest Louisiana, today announced a $1.8 million grant and loan to upgrade existing wastewater treatment and pump stations in Maurice.

Safe, clean drinking water is critical to a town’s growth, and this grant and loan enables families in Maurice to be more confident with their tap water,” Boustany said. I am pleased with this grant because it will help Maurice meet its growing demand. This is an important project for the community, and I know it will be well spent.

The grant and loan are part of USDA’s Rural Development Water and Waste Disposal program. The Maurice wastewater treatment plant will be upgraded as well as three pump stations in order to meet the town’s growth. The Maurice project received a $596,500 grant and a $1,214,000 loan payable over 40 years.
